**Release checklist — Item 7: Formula sandbox hardening**

Confirm Ledgerpine's user-formula sandbox ships with scope isolation enforced. Verify: escape-attempt test suite green, resource caps active (CPU, memory, eval depth), legacy unsafe evaluator removed from the artifact. No release without security sign-off on this item. Sign-off applies only to the exact build recorded below.

trace token, fafog-kageg: htk4_98e6

**Vendor note: Inkmill markdown pipeline**

Rendering for Parchway docs is outsourced to Inkmill under an annual contract, renewing each March. They handle sanitization and PDF export; we own the upload queue. SLA: 4-hour response on rendering failures. Escalate only after two failed retries. Their support desk is reachable at the address below.

billing contact of hahaf-baguf = zorael.tammir.jorius@sivrelhq.internal

## Deploying the Gatewick Proctor Queue

Deploys are pretty painless: push to main, wait for the pipeline, then watch the queue drain dashboard for five minutes. If candidates pile up mid-exam, roll back first and ask questions later — the queue replays safely. Everything the workers care about lives in one config block, shown here for reference.

settings of bafof-yagef:
JOROX_PIN=8740
JOROX_TENANT=pelox
JOROX_METRICS_HOST=metrics.jorox.qorvelworks.internal
JOROX_SEAL=seal_c78f63c1
JOROX_STANDBY_TEAM=norax

Handover note — Crumbwheel order cutoffs.

Welcome aboard. The bakery cutoff rule in Crumbwheel closes same-day orders at 14:00 local to each storefront, not UTC — this has bitten us twice. Holiday overrides live in the calendar service and take precedence silently, so always check there first when a cutoff looks wrong. To unlock the calendar service's admin console after a restart, enter the recovery passphrase below.

vault phrase of bagap-bahaf = silion-pelox-sorox-casdor-quenwyn-fraax-eliox-praael-kelion-quenvan-kasox-rusael-norius-belvan